Celtic face Motherwell on Saturday and will look to at least maintain their five-point lead over Aberdeen.
When the two teams met at Fir Park back in October, Celtic won 2-1 but lost the most recent fixture at Celtic Park in December.
This is the final league game before the split, and Mark McGhee’s side are finely poised in fourth place, and are also the in-form team in Scotland, having won their last five games.
